  • Abstract
    A flexible, configurable turbo codec engine for both military and commercial applications has recently been developed at Titan Systems under a jointly funded dual use science and technology (DUS&T) program sponsored by the US Army CECOM. Results indicate that the universal turbo codec (UTC) provides 2-4 dB of performance improvement over standard convolutional codes and greater than 1 dB improvement over turbo product codes. The performance, configuration, features and implementation of the UTC using commercial-off-the-shelf (COTS) hardware is described.
